Behavioral science research is a large, multifaceted field, embrace a wide array of disciplines. The field employs a variety of methodolog ical approaches including surveys and questionnaires, interviews, randomized clinical trials, direct observation, physiological manipulations and recording, descriptive methods, laboratory and field experiments, standardized tests, economic analyses, statistical modeling, ethnography, and evaluation.Yet, behavioral sciences research is not restricted to a set of disciplines or methodological approaches. Instead, the field is defined by substantive areas of research that transcend disciplinary and methodological boundaries. In addition, several find cross-cutting themes characterize kindly and behavioral sciences research. These include an emphasis on theory-driven research the search for general principles of behavioral and affable run the importance ascribed to a developmental, lifespan perspective an emphasis on individual variation, and variation across sociodemographic categories such as gender, age, and sociocultural status and a focus on both the affectionate and biolog ical contexts of behavior.The upshot areas of behavioral and neighborly sciences research are divided into elementary or fundamental research and employ research. The staple fiber and utilise research distinction serves more of an organizational function for purposesof this definition, rather than representing firm boundaries within the field. Indeed, many studies know both elementary and applied components. Moreover, basic and applied research is often complementary. staple research a great deal provides the foundation for consequent applied research, and applied research often influences the direction of basic research. Economics is by chance the oldest of the social sciences, with its concern with wealth and distress, trade and industry. However, legitimate economic cerebration chiefly dates from the close three centuries and is associated with the great names in economic mentation, such as tou r Smith, Robert Malthus, David Ricardo, John Stuart Mill, and Karl Marx. current economics is an advanced study of production, employment, exchange, and enjoyment driven by sophisticated mathematical models. Basically, the field breaks into two distinctive areas microeconomics and macroeconomics. Microeconomics is mostly concern with issues such as agonistic markets, wage rates, and acquire margins. Macroeconomics deals with broader issues, such as national in bewilder, employment, and economic systems. The relationship between economics and health is obvious because in developed countries the function of earn national product consumed by the health consider industry is significant, generally ranging from 5 to 15 percent of the gross national product.In the uglyer countries, the cost of affection to the overall scrimping can abolish the sound economic development of the country. In recent long time at that place has been a concern with both the global economic burden of infirmity as well as with enthronization in health. That poverty is highly related to poor public health is a widely current tenet of modernday thinking in public health. However, economic systems ranging from for conduce enterprise through liberal composeivism and communism pass rather differing alternatives to the decline of poverty and the dissemination of economic resourcefulnesss. psychological science. Sociology is perhaps the broadest of the social science fields applied to public health.It is overly characterized by being eclectic in its borrowing from the other social sciences. Thus, sociology is as well concerned with organizations, economics, and political issues, as well as individual behaviors in relation to the broader social milieu. A key concept in sociology, however, is an emphasis on society rather than the individual. The individual is viewed as an actor within a larger social process. This distinguishes the field from psychology. Thus the emphasis is on units of analysis at the collective level such as the family, the group, the neighborhood, the city, the organization, the state, and the world. Sociology is concerned with how the social fabric or social structure is maintained, and how social processes, such as conflict and resolution, relate to the nourishm ent and change of social structures. A sociologist studies processes that create, maintain, and go along a social system, such as a health care system in a country. The scientific component of this study would be the concern with the processes correct and shaping the healthcare system. Sociology assumes that social structure and social processes are real complex.Definition of organizational behaviourorganisational behavior is a field of study that investigates the impact of individuals, groups and structures upon behavior within an organization.
